编程中的flot什么意思

不及物动词 其他 22

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    "flot"是一个用于绘制交互式浏览器图表的JavaScript库。它提供了一套简单易用的API,可以在网页上创建各种类型的图表,如折线图、柱状图、饼图等。"flot"能够通过使用HTML5画布或者JavaScript绘制SVG图形来实现可视化效果。

    "flot"库的主要特点包括:

    1. 简单易用:flot提供了一套简洁、明了的API,使得用户可以轻松地创建、配置和更新图表。它支持各种自定义选项,包括颜色、线型、线条宽度、图例等。

    2. 交互性:flot可以通过鼠标交互来实现图表的缩放、移动、高亮显示等功能。用户可以通过鼠标点击和拖动来与图表进行交互,并可以通过鼠标悬停来显示数据的详细信息。

    3. 兼容性:flot是跨浏览器兼容的,可以在主流的现代浏览器中运行,并能够适应不同尺寸的屏幕。它还支持响应式设计,可以在不同设备上呈现适合的布局和样式。

    4. 强大的功能:除了基本的图表类型,flot还提供了一些高级功能,如时间轴、自动缩放、动画效果等。它还支持图表的多个系列、多个坐标系,并可以与其他JavaScript库(如jQuery)进行集成。

    总之,flot是一个功能强大且易于使用的JavaScript图表库,可以帮助开发人员在网页上创建交互式的数据可视化图表。它适用于各种应用场景,包括数据分析、报表生成、实时监控等。无论是初学者还是有经验的开发人员,都可以从flot中受益,并将其应用到自己的项目中。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在编程中,Flot是一个用于绘制动态、交互式和可定制的图表的JavaScript库。它是基于jQuery库开发的,并且非常适用于在网页上展示数据。Flot提供了各种类型的图表,包括折线图、柱状图、饼图等,用户可以根据自己的需求进行选择和定制。

    以下是在编程中使用Flot的一些重要特性和功能:

    1. 动态和交互式图表:Flot允许用户创建动态和交互式的图表,可以在图表上进行放大、缩小以及平移操作。用户还可以添加鼠标悬停提示,以显示鼠标指向的数据点的详细信息。

    2. 多种图表类型:Flot支持多种常用的图表类型,包括折线图、柱状图、饼图、面积图等。用户可以根据自己的需求选择适当的图表类型来展示数据。

    3. 数据可视化:Flot提供了丰富的方法和选项来定制和美化图表,包括设置标题、轴标签、图例等。用户可以根据自己的喜好和需求来调整图表的外观和样式。

    4. 数据解析和处理:Flot提供了一套强大的API,可以帮助用户解析和处理数据。用户可以使用这些API来将数据转换为适合绘图的格式,并进行必要的数据处理和计算。

    5. 扩展性和可定制性:Flot具有很高的扩展性和可定制性。用户可以使用插件和扩展来增加额外的功能和图表类型。此外,Flot还提供了丰富的选项和配置,允许用户根据自己的需求对图表进行定制。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Flot是一个基于JavaScript的绘图库,用于创建交互式的图表和数据可视化。它基于HTML5 Canvas元素和jQuery库,并提供了一套简单易用的API,可以轻松地在网页中绘制各种类型的图表,如折线图、柱状图、饼图等。

    Flot的主要特点包括:

    • 简洁易用:Flot提供了简单明了的API接口,使用起来非常方便。只需引入相应的JavaScript文件,调用相关函数即可绘制图表。
    • 轻量级:Flot的核心文件非常小,只有几十KB大小,加载速度快,对网页性能影响较小。
    • 兼容性好:Flot兼容各种现代的浏览器,包括Chrome、Firefox、Safari等,并且在移动设备上也能良好地运行。
    • 支持交互和动画效果:Flot可以通过鼠标交互来实现缩放、平移、选取数据等功能,同时还支持动画效果,可以给图表添加渐变、过渡等效果。
    • 丰富的配置选项:Flot提供了大量的配置选项,可以自定义图表的样式、颜色、字体、刻度等属性,满足不同的需求。

    使用Flot绘制图表的步骤如下:

    1. 引入Flot的JavaScript文件:在HTML页面中引入Flot的核心库文件和相关插件的JavaScript文件。
    <script src="jquery.min.js"></script>
    <script src="jquery.flot.js"></script>
    
    1. 创建一个用于显示图表的DOM元素:在HTML页面中添加一个canvas元素来作为图表的容器。
    <div id="placeholder" style="width:600px;height:400px;"></div>
    
    1. 准备数据:定义一个数组来存储要绘制的数据。根据图表的类型,数据可以是一维或二维的数组。
    var data = [
      [0, 0], [1, 1], [2, 4], [3, 9], [4, 16]
    ];
    
    1. 调用Flot的绘图函数:使用Flot提供的API函数来绘制图表,传入数据和相应的配置选项。
    $.plot($("#placeholder"), [data], options);
    
    1. 自定义配置选项:根据需要,可以使用配置选项来设置图表的样式、刻度、标签等属性。
    var options = {
      series: {
        lines: { show: true },
        points: { show: true }
      },
      xaxis: {
        tickSize: 1
      },
      yaxis: {
        tickSize: 5
      }
    };
    

    通过以上步骤,就可以使用Flot库来创建各种类型的交互式图表。Flot还提供了许多其他的功能和扩展,如支持多个数据系列、标签和标题、图例、自定义事件等,可以根据具体需求进行进一步的学习和使用。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部